Installation

There are many aspects to think about when installing an electric fireplace that is wall-mounted. First, you'll need to decide whether you want the fireplace mounted or recessed. Depending on the look you're going for either one is suitable. A recessed model requires you to frame out space within the wall, while a fire that is mounted can be placed on the wall in a straight line for an elegant look.

When selecting a location for your new wall mounted electric fire it is recommended to ensure that the chosen location is close enough to an electrical outlet for the fire's power cable to reach. You might want to move the plug socket closer to the fireplace for a more streamlined look and to avoid having any unattractive cable showing.

It's time to get the tools. Fitting a wall-mounted electric fire is fairly simple and can be completed in less than half an hour provided you have the proper tools to complete the task. A spirit level is necessary to ensure that the mounting bracket is positioned straight against the wall. You will also require a screwdriver as well as an electric drill. A ladder or scaffolding is required to reach the hard-to-reach areas of the room.

You'll then need to measure the width and height of the wall mounting area the wall in order to determine the dimensions of the fireplace frame you'll need. You can buy a fireplace wall kit which includes everything you require to build the frame. You can also use blocks to build an individual wall to place the fireplace.

Before you start drilling into the wall it's best to test your fireplace to be sure it's functioning properly. Before beginning the installation connect it to the electrical outlet and test out the lights and heat. When the framing has been completed, you can attach the fireplace to the brackets for mounting and hang the glass face.

Safety

Electric fireplaces provide the ambience of a traditional fire without the dangers of real flames and sparks. However, you must follow basic safety guidelines when using these types of heaters in your home. Keep all objects from the heat, including your fingers. Also, make sure that the fireplace well-ventilated to prevent it from overheating. Unplug the unit whenever it is not being used.

Electric fireplaces don't create flames. Instead, they make use of LED lights, video images or mist. This means that it does not generate the extreme heat that could alter the shape of a wooden or metallic mantel ledge, or burn flames that can ignite flammable wall coverings, fabrics and furnishings. This is a major reason why many people prefer electric fireplaces over their traditional counterparts to be used in their homes.

The heat from an electric fireplace that is mounted on a wall can be warm and released at the front. This is why it is crucial to know where the heating vents are on the fireplace when deciding which one to buy. It is recommended that you have a distance of 3 feet between the heat vent on the fireplace and any combustible furniture or walls in your home.

It is important to remember that not all electric fire places generate the same amount of heat. Check the BTUs of each model before purchasing. The greater the number of BTU's, the more the space will be heated.

Take a look at the security features of a wall-mounted electric fireplace. Choose a fireplace that is certified by CSA for electrical safety and includes an automatic shut-off as well as thermal overload protection. This will lower the chance of a fire risk or short circuits to electrical wires.

It is also important to regularly inspect the fireplace for signs of wear and tear. Also, be sure that the fireplace is free of flammable materials and don't place any furniture or drapes over it. Also, ensure that it is not plugged into the power source sharing space with other equipment and appliances to avoid overloading the outlet.
